RUNBOOK — Props Transfer, "Moonlight Carousel" Tour

Crate the mirrored throne and the two collapsible arches by 07:00. Label each crate with the Halverton venue code, not the depot code. Foam only — no straw packing, per insurance. Driver from Brindlecart Freight arrives 08:15; load dock B. Office manager signs the manifest, keeps the pink copy, and logs crate weights in the tour binder. The courier will expect the confirmation phrase before release; use the one below.

handover note for yagef-bagep: the drudor pelius courier leaves the kasdor zorvan norir ledger at gate 8016 under passcode 755406

Welcome aboard! Quick context before the leadership review: we're winding down the Marlow Creek office. Only nine staff remain, most already slated for remote roles with Tessaline Group. Lease ends in March, so timing is friendly. Facilities has the exit checklist handled. Before the review, read the confidential note below on our plans.

board note of baguf-fafog: Kasixox Foods plans to lower the Drueth list price by 48 percent in March.

## Account Recovery — Trailnote Offline Mode

When a surveyor's Trailnote app has been offline for 30+ days, their local credentials expire and sync refuses to resume. Don't make them wipe the device — all their unsynced field data lives there! Instead, open the support console, pick "Offline Reinstate," and enter their handle. The console will ask for the support team's shared recovery passphrase before issuing a reinstatement token. Use the one below.

unlock words, bagaf-fajeg: zorael-kelax-fraath-quenix-eliok-sileth-aldmir-wenir-druiel

**Ticket #4412 — Autocomplete index crawling on staging**

Hey plugin folks — if your Quillbox extensions feel sluggish lately, it's not you. The staging autocomplete index was misconfigured after the Lanternfall migration: the shard count got set to 1, so every keystroke hammers a single node. We've bumped it back to 8 and re-enabled warm caching, but plugins still need the indexer token to query the rebuilt cluster. Add the usual settings to your .env, then append the following line so your plugin can authenticate against the new index.

secret setting of bajeg-yahog: LEDGER_TOKEN20=f833f3e2e6625ec0dee3